Norway - Treatment and Disposal of Non-hazardous Waste Hours Worked

Since 2014, Norway Treatment and Disposal of Non-Hazardous Waste Hours Worked grew 1.9% year on year. With 851,328 Hours in 2019, the country was number 19 among other countries in Treatment and Disposal of Non-Hazardous Waste Hours Worked. Norway is overtaken by Sweden, which was number 18 with 1,232,689 Hours and is followed by Latvia at 713,956 Hours. Spain lead the ranking with 43,793,959.9 Hours in 2019, that is an increase of 2.6% versus 2018. United Kingdom, Italy and Poland resp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Cyprus recorded the best 5 years average growth at +29.4% per year, while Netherlands was the worst growing country at -1.4% per year.
